| - | GLP1-T has also garnered attention as a potential treatment for obesity. The appetite-suppressing effects of GLP1-T are attributed to its action on the central nervous system, where it influences satiety pathways. Clinical studies have reported substantial weight loss in obese individuals treated with GLP1-T, highlighting its dual role in managing both diabetes and obesity. | + | GLP1-T has also garnered attention as a potential treatment for obesity. | - | As the field of personalized medicine continues to evolve, there is a growing interest in tailoring GLP1[[https:// | + | As the field of personalized medicine continues to evolve, there is a growing interest in tailoring GLP1-T therapy to individual patient profiles. Genetic factors, lifestyle, and comorbid conditions can influence the response to GLP1-T, and understanding these variables will help clinicians optimize treatment strategies. Biomarker research may play a crucial role in identifying patients who are most likely to benefit from GLP1-T therapy. |
